Make Ahead and Storage

Storing Leftovers

After you enjoy this delightful Marshmallow Whip Cheesecake, wrap any leftovers tightly with plastic wrap or place them in an airtight container. Store it in the refrigerator, where it will stay fresh and maintain its creamy texture for up to 3 days.

Freezing

If you want to keep it a little longer, you can freeze the cheesecake for up to one month. Make sure to cover it well with plastic wrap and a layer of foil to prevent freezer burn. Thaw in the fridge overnight when you’re ready to indulge again.

Reheating

This cheesecake is best enjoyed cold, so there’s no need for reheating. Just take it out of the fridge a few minutes before serving to soften slightly and reveal those wonderful, fluffy layers.

FAQs

Can I use a homemade crust instead of a store-bought graham cracker crust?

Absolutely! A homemade graham cracker crust with melted butter and a touch of sugar can add an extra layer of flavor and freshness that complements the Marshmallow Whip Cheesecake beautifully.

Is marshmallow creme the same as marshmallow fluff?

Yes, marshmallow creme and marshmallow fluff are very similar and can be used interchangeably in this recipe without any issue. Both bring that sweet, airy texture that defines the cheesecake.

Can I substitute the whipped topping for homemade whipped cream?

Yes, using homemade whipped cream is a lovely option and makes the dessert feel extra special. Just be sure to whip it to soft peaks so it folds in easily without deflating your filling.

How long does the Marshmallow Whip Cheesecake need to chill?

Chilling for at least 4 hours is important to let the dessert firm up, but overnight chilling is ideal for the best flavor and texture.

Can I add other flavors to the Marshmallow Whip Cheesecake?

Definitely! You can fold in a little lemon zest, chocolate chips, or even a swirl of fruit preserves to customize your cheesecake and make it your own.

Marshmallow Whip Cheesecake Recipe

This Marshmallow Whip Cheesecake is a light and fluffy dessert featuring a creamy blend of cream cheese, marshmallow creme, and whipped topping nestled in a crunchy graham cracker crust. Perfect for an easy, no-bake treat that’s sweet, airy, and delightful to serve at any occasion.

  • Author: Lila
  • Prep Time: 15 minutes
  • Cook Time: 0 minutes
  • Total Time: 4 hours 15 minutes
  • Yield: 8 servings 1x
  • Category: Dessert
  • Method: No-Bake
  • Cuisine: American
  • Diet: Vegetarian

Ingredients

Scale

Crust

  • 1 (9-inch) graham cracker crust

Filling

  • 1 (8 oz) package cream cheese, softened
  • 1 (7 oz) jar marshmallow creme
  • 1 (8 oz) tub whipped topping (Cool Whip), thawed
  • 1 tsp vanilla extract

Optional Garnish

  • Whipped cream or favorite topping for garnish

Instructions

  1. Prepare the cream cheese: Beat the softened cream cheese in a large bowl using an electric mixer until it becomes smooth and fluffy, ensuring there are no lumps for a silky texture.
  2. Add marshmallow and vanilla: Mix in the marshmallow creme and vanilla extract with the cream cheese until well blended, creating a sweet and creamy base.
  3. Fold in whipped topping: Gently fold the thawed whipped topping into the cream cheese mixture until fully combined to maintain the light and airy consistency.
  4. Spread into crust: Evenly spread the combined filling into the pre-made graham cracker crust, smoothing the top with a spatula for an attractive finish.
  5. Chill the cheesecake: Place the assembled cheesecake in the refrigerator and chill for at least 4 hours, preferably overnight, so it sets properly and flavors meld together.
  6. Garnish and serve: Before serving, garnish with additional whipped cream or your favorite toppings for added flavor and presentation.

Notes

  • For best results, allow cream cheese to come to room temperature before starting the recipe for smoother mixing.
  • You can substitute the graham cracker crust with a chocolate or chocolate cookie crust for a different flavor profile.
  • This dessert is best chilled overnight to achieve optimal firmness and taste.
  • Store leftover cheesecake tightly covered in the refrigerator for up to 3 days.
  • Optional toppings include fresh berries, chocolate shavings, or a drizzle of caramel sauce.
